在互联网时代,Java Web技术已经成为企业级应用开发的主流技术之一。其中,Java Web布局技术更是至关重要的一环,它直接影响到应用的用户体验和界面美观。本文将从Java Web布局技术的概念、常用布局方式以及实际应用等方面进行详细解析,帮助读者深入了解并掌握这一技术。
一、Java Web布局技术概述
1. 什么是Java Web布局技术?
Java Web布局技术是指在Java Web应用中,如何将页面元素(如文本、图片、按钮等)按照一定的规则进行排列和组合,以实现美观、易用的界面效果。
2. Java Web布局技术的意义
良好的布局设计可以使页面更加美观、易用,提升用户体验,同时也有利于搜索引擎优化(SEO)。
二、Java Web布局方式
1. 表格布局(Table Layout)
表格布局是Java Web布局技术中较为传统的一种方式,通过表格元素(
)实现元素的排列。但表格布局存在布局复杂、灵活性差等缺点。
2. 浮动布局(Float Layout) 浮动布局是通过CSS中的float属性实现元素的浮动排列,具有较好的灵活性和扩展性。但浮动布局也容易导致布局错乱、兼容性问题。 3. 弹性布局(Flexbox Layout) 弹性布局是一种基于CSS的布局方式,通过设置容器元素的display属性为flex,从而实现元素的灵活排列。弹性布局具有布局简单、兼容性好等优点。 4. 响应式布局(Responsive Layout) 响应式布局是指根据不同设备的屏幕尺寸,动态调整页面布局,以适应各种设备。实现响应式布局主要依靠CSS媒体查询(Media Queries)和弹性布局等技术。 三、Java Web布局技术应用 1. 常见布局案例 (1)首页导航栏:使用浮动布局实现导航栏的横向排列,同时利用弹性布局实现导航栏在不同屏幕尺寸下的自适应。 (2)内容区域:使用弹性布局实现内容区域的横向、纵向排列,以及响应式布局实现内容在不同设备下的自适应。 (3)图片轮播:使用浮动布局实现图片的横向排列,同时利用CSS动画实现图片的轮播效果。 2. 布局优化 (1)避免使用表格布局:尽量使用浮动布局、弹性布局或响应式布局,以提高布局的灵活性和兼容性。 (2)精简CSS代码:通过合并同类选择器、提取重复样式等方式,精简CSS代码,提高页面加载速度。 (3)优化图片资源:针对不同设备,使用不同尺寸的图片资源,以减少数据传输量,提高页面加载速度。 Java Web布局技术在现代Web应用开发中扮演着重要角色。掌握并熟练运用Java Web布局技术,将为你的应用带来更加美观、易用的界面效果。希望本文能对你有所帮助,让你在Java Web布局技术领域取得更好的成果。 发表评论 |
还没有评论,来说两句吧...